Karachi: The price of gold per tola has significantly increase in Pakistan today (Thursday).
According to the details, the price of gold has increased by Rs2200 per tola in the country.
According to the All Pakistan Gems and Jewelers Association (APGJA), after an increase of Rs2200, 24 karat gold has settled at Rs222,800 per tola.
It has also been stated by the association that after an increase of 1886 rupees, the price of 10 grams of 24 karat gold has been sold at the rate of Rs191,015.
The price of gold in the global bullion market increased by 20 dollars to settle at $2085 per ounce.
